Jesse Ryder assault: Man arrested by New Zealand police (VIDEO)

New Zealand police have arrested a man over the assault on cricketer Jesse Ryder outside a bar in Christchurch.

The 20-year-old suspect was interviewed regarding his involvement in the attack on the 28-year-old middle-order batsman. He was arrested and charged with assault, and is due to appear in the Christchurch District Court on April 4.

New Zealand’s hottest wife competition has a winner

Yes, she is the chick with a dead boar slung on her shoulders

She isn’t just a pretty face. She is also a talented boar hunter.

With credentials like these, it's obvious that when it comes to beauty pageants nobody can keep up with the women of New Zealand.

Jenna Curtis of Taranaki has won the crown of Rock Wife 2012, a nationwide radio competition by The Rock station.

The competition's noble goal? To find New Zealand's hottest and best outdoor partner.

The moment after her lucky man, Donald Moratti, sent in a picture of his “missus” with a dead boar slung over her shoulders, New Zealand had its new favorite it girl.

According to The Rock, Curtis received 23 percent of the total votes from the public. She was described as representing “the rugged, wild chick that every red blooded Kiwi male dreams of."

The radio station also said she proved girls can get "down and dirty with nature and still look bloody good doing it."

According to TVNZ, the win follows controversy that erupted after a photo of another wild Kiwi chick hit the news last month.
